Clavicle Fractures
Definition and Prevalence of Clavicle Fractures
Clavicle fractures are breaks in the collarbone, that S-shaped bone connecting your sternum to your shoulder blade. These fractures typically result from direct impact to the shoulder or from falling onto an outstretched arm during motorcycle accidents.
The collarbone is particularly vulnerable during motorcycle crashes because it often absorbs the initial impact when riders are thrown from their bikes. Data shows that clavicle fractures account for approximately 5-10% of all fractures seen in motorcycle accidents, making them one of the most common upper body injuries for riders.
Clavicle Fracture Diagnosis Methods
When you arrive at the emergency room after a motorcycle accident with shoulder pain, doctors will immediately suspect a possible clavicle fracture. The diagnosis process typically involves:
- X-rays: Standard anteroposterior views are the first-line imaging technique for suspected clavicle fractures. These images can identify the location and pattern of the fracture.
- CT scans: For more complex fractures or when surgical intervention might be necessary, computed tomography provides detailed 3D images of the fracture. CT scans help surgeons understand the precise fracture configuration, displaced fragments, and involvement of surrounding structures. https://etemilaw.com/traumatic-brain-injury-motorcycle-accident-guide
These imaging techniques are crucial for determining the severity of the fracture and choosing the appropriate treatment approach.
Treatment Options for Clavicle Fractures
Not all clavicle fractures require surgery. Treatment options typically fall into two categories:
Conservative Treatment:
- Appropriate for non-displaced or minimally displaced fractures
- Involves wearing a sling or figure-8 bandage for 4-8 weeks
- Pain management with medications
- Gradual return to activities as the bone heals
Surgical Intervention:
- Necessary for significantly displaced fractures (>2cm displacement)
- Required when bone fragments pierce the skin (open fractures)
- Indicated for fractures with multiple fragments (comminuted)
- Recommended when there’s significant shortening of the clavicle
- Often chosen for active individuals who need faster return to activities

The decision between conservative treatment and plate surgery depends on fracture characteristics, patient factors, and functional requirements.
Clavicle Fracture Plate Surgery Recovery Time Breakdown
Immediate Post-Surgery Period (1-2 weeks)
The first two weeks after clavicle fracture plate surgery are critical for initial healing. During this period:
- Your arm will remain immobilized in a sling to protect the surgical site
- Pain and swelling are managed with prescribed medications and ice therapy
- Wound care is essential to prevent infection
- Minimal shoulder movement is allowed to prevent stiffness while protecting the repair
- You’ll have follow-up appointments to monitor wound healing
This initial phase focuses primarily on pain control and protecting the surgical repair while your body begins the healing process.
Early Rehabilitation Phase (2-6 weeks)
Around the two-week mark, your surgeon will typically begin introducing gentle movement:
- Passive range-of-motion exercises are started under physical therapy supervision
- These gentle movements prevent shoulder stiffness without stressing the healing bone
- The sling is still used for protection during daily activities
- Pendulum exercises may be introduced to maintain mobility
- Pain typically begins to decrease significantly during this period
The early rehabilitation phase focuses on maintaining shoulder mobility while still protecting the healing clavicle.
Mid-Term Recovery (6-12 weeks)
As healing progresses, your activities will gradually increase:
- Active motion exercises begin, allowing you to move your arm independently
- Light resistance training is introduced around 8-10 weeks
- The sling is gradually discontinued
- You may return to light daily activities
- X-rays are taken to confirm bone healing is proceeding as expected
- Driving may be permitted, depending on your surgeon’s assessment
During this phase, the focus shifts from protection to restoration of function through progressively challenging exercises.
Long-Term Healing (3-6 months)
The final phase of recovery focuses on returning to full function:
- Strengthening exercises become more intensive
- Return to normal activities, including work, is usually possible
- Athletic activities and high-impact sports typically resume after 4-6 months
- Hardware removal surgery may be considered after complete healing (typically 12+ months)
- Full recovery with normal strength and function is expected, though factors like age and overall health may affect timelines
Complete bone healing and return to pre-injury function typically take 3-6 months, though some patients report minor residual symptoms for up to a year.
Physical Therapy Requirements
Physical therapy plays a crucial role in optimal recovery from clavicle fracture plate surgery:
- Early phase (2-6 weeks): Focuses on passive range-of-motion exercises and pain management techniques
- Middle phase (6-12 weeks): Incorporates active movement and light strengthening exercises
- Late phase (3-6 months): Emphasizes progressive strengthening, endurance training, and sport-specific activities
Consistent adherence to physical therapy protocols significantly improves outcomes and reduces recovery time. Tibia Plateau Fracture
Tibia Plateau Fracture Motorcycle Impact Mechanism
Tibia plateau fractures represent some of the most serious lower extremity injuries sustained in motorcycle accidents. These fractures occur when tremendous force is applied directly to the knee during a collision or side impact. Typically, they happen when:
- A motorcycle is struck from the side, forcing the knee into an object
- The rider’s leg is caught between the motorcycle and another vehicle
- Direct impact to the knee occurs during a fall or slide
The tibia plateau is the upper portion of the shinbone that forms part of the knee joint. When fractured, it disrupts the critical load-bearing surface of the knee, potentially leading to long-term mobility issues.
Classification of Fracture Types
Tibia plateau fractures are typically classified using the Schatzker classification system, which divides these injuries into six types based on pattern and severity:
- Type I: Simple split fracture of the lateral plateau
- Type II: Split and depression of the lateral plateau
- Type III: Pure depression of the lateral plateau
- Type IV: Fracture of the medial plateau
- Type V: Bicondylar fracture involving both plateaus
- Type VI: Fracture with separation of the metaphysis from the diaphysis
